PHP Класс Xinax\LaravelGettext\Config\Models\Config

Показать файл Открыть проект Примеры использования класса

Защищенные свойства (Protected)

Свойство Тип Описание
$adapter string The adapter class used to sync with laravel locale
$categories Locale categories
$customLocale Custom locale name Used when needed locales are unavalilable
$domain string Gettext domain
$encoding string Charset encoding for files
$fallbackLocale string Fallback locale
$handler Core translation handler
$keywordsList Poedit keywords list
$locale string Full ISO Locale (en_EN)
$project string Project identifier
$relativePath Default relative path
$sessionIdentifier string Session identifier
$sourcePaths array Source paths
$supportedLocales array Supported locales
$syncLaravel Sync with laravel locale
$translationsPath string Path to translation files
$translator string Translator contact data

Открытые методы

Метод Описание
__construct ( )
getAdapter ( ) : string Gets the adapter class.
getAllDomains ( ) : array Return an array with all domain names
getCategories ( ) : array Gets categories
getCustomLocale ( ) : boolean Gets C locale setting.
getDomain ( ) : string
getEncoding ( ) : string
getFallbackLocale ( ) : string
getHandler ( ) : mixed Returns the handler name
getKeywordsList ( ) : mixed Gets the Poedit keywords list.
getLocale ( ) : string
getProject ( ) : string
getRelativePath ( )
getSessionIdentifier ( ) : string
getSourcePaths ( ) : array
getSourcesFromDomain ( $domain ) : array Return all routes for a single domain
getSupportedLocales ( ) : array
getSyncLaravel ( ) : mixed Gets the Sync with laravel locale.
getTranslationsPath ( ) : string
getTranslator ( ) : string
isSyncLaravel ( ) : boolean
setAdapter ( string $adapter )
setCategories ( array $categories ) : self Sets categories
setCustomLocale ( $customLocale ) : self Sets if will use C locale structure.
setDomain ( string $domain )
setEncoding ( string $encoding )
setFallbackLocale ( string $fallbackLocale )
setHandler ( $handler ) Sets the handler type. Also check for valid handler name
setKeywordsList ( mixed $keywordsList ) : self Sets the Poedit keywords list.
setLocale ( string $locale )
setProject ( string $project )
setRelativePath ( $path )
setSessionIdentifier ( string $sessionIdentifier )
setSourcePaths ( array $sourcePaths )
setSupportedLocales ( array $supportedLocales )
setSyncLaravel ( boolean $syncLaravel )
setTranslationsPath ( string $translationsPath )
setTranslator ( string $translator )

Описание методов

__construct() публичный метод

public __construct ( )

getAdapter() публичный метод

Gets the adapter class.
public getAdapter ( ) : string
Результат string

getAllDomains() публичный метод

Return an array with all domain names
public getAllDomains ( ) : array
Результат array

getCategories() публичный метод

Gets categories
public getCategories ( ) : array
Результат array

getCustomLocale() публичный метод

Gets C locale setting.
public getCustomLocale ( ) : boolean
Результат boolean

getDomain() публичный метод

public getDomain ( ) : string
Результат string

getEncoding() публичный метод

public getEncoding ( ) : string
Результат string

getFallbackLocale() публичный метод

public getFallbackLocale ( ) : string
Результат string

getHandler() публичный метод

Returns the handler name
public getHandler ( ) : mixed
Результат mixed

getKeywordsList() публичный метод

Gets the Poedit keywords list.
public getKeywordsList ( ) : mixed
Результат mixed

getLocale() публичный метод

public getLocale ( ) : string
Результат string

getProject() публичный метод

public getProject ( ) : string
Результат string

getRelativePath() публичный метод

public getRelativePath ( )

getSessionIdentifier() публичный метод

public getSessionIdentifier ( ) : string
Результат string

getSourcePaths() публичный метод

public getSourcePaths ( ) : array
Результат array

getSourcesFromDomain() публичный метод

Return all routes for a single domain
public getSourcesFromDomain ( $domain ) : array
$domain
Результат array

getSupportedLocales() публичный метод

public getSupportedLocales ( ) : array
Результат array

getSyncLaravel() публичный метод

Gets the Sync with laravel locale.
public getSyncLaravel ( ) : mixed
Результат mixed

getTranslationsPath() публичный метод

public getTranslationsPath ( ) : string
Результат string

getTranslator() публичный метод

public getTranslator ( ) : string
Результат string

isSyncLaravel() публичный метод

public isSyncLaravel ( ) : boolean
Результат boolean

setAdapter() публичный метод

public setAdapter ( string $adapter )
$adapter string

setCategories() публичный метод

Sets categories
public setCategories ( array $categories ) : self
$categories array
Результат self

setCustomLocale() публичный метод

Sets if will use C locale structure.
public setCustomLocale ( $customLocale ) : self
Результат self

setDomain() публичный метод

public setDomain ( string $domain )
$domain string

setEncoding() публичный метод

public setEncoding ( string $encoding )
$encoding string

setFallbackLocale() публичный метод

public setFallbackLocale ( string $fallbackLocale )
$fallbackLocale string

setHandler() публичный метод

Sets the handler type. Also check for valid handler name
public setHandler ( $handler )
$handler

setKeywordsList() публичный метод

Sets the Poedit keywords list.
public setKeywordsList ( mixed $keywordsList ) : self
$keywordsList mixed the keywords list
Результат self

setLocale() публичный метод

public setLocale ( string $locale )
$locale string

setProject() публичный метод

public setProject ( string $project )
$project string

setRelativePath() публичный метод

public setRelativePath ( $path )

setSessionIdentifier() публичный метод

public setSessionIdentifier ( string $sessionIdentifier )
$sessionIdentifier string

setSourcePaths() публичный метод

public setSourcePaths ( array $sourcePaths )
$sourcePaths array

setSupportedLocales() публичный метод

public setSupportedLocales ( array $supportedLocales )
$supportedLocales array

setSyncLaravel() публичный метод

public setSyncLaravel ( boolean $syncLaravel )
$syncLaravel boolean

setTranslationsPath() публичный метод

public setTranslationsPath ( string $translationsPath )
$translationsPath string

setTranslator() публичный метод

public setTranslator ( string $translator )
$translator string

Описание свойств

$adapter защищенное свойство

The adapter class used to sync with laravel locale
protected string $adapter
Результат string

$categories защищенное свойство

Locale categories
protected $categories

$customLocale защищенное свойство

Custom locale name Used when needed locales are unavalilable
protected $customLocale

$domain защищенное свойство

Gettext domain
protected string $domain
Результат string

$encoding защищенное свойство

Charset encoding for files
protected string $encoding
Результат string

$fallbackLocale защищенное свойство

Fallback locale
protected string $fallbackLocale
Результат string

$handler защищенное свойство

Core translation handler
protected $handler

$keywordsList защищенное свойство

Poedit keywords list
protected $keywordsList

$locale защищенное свойство

Full ISO Locale (en_EN)
protected string $locale
Результат string

$project защищенное свойство

Project identifier
protected string $project
Результат string

$relativePath защищенное свойство

Default relative path
protected $relativePath

$sessionIdentifier защищенное свойство

Session identifier
protected string $sessionIdentifier
Результат string

$sourcePaths защищенное свойство

Source paths
protected array $sourcePaths
Результат array

$supportedLocales защищенное свойство

Supported locales
protected array $supportedLocales
Результат array

$syncLaravel защищенное свойство

Sync with laravel locale
protected $syncLaravel

$translationsPath защищенное свойство

Path to translation files
protected string $translationsPath
Результат string

$translator защищенное свойство

Translator contact data
protected string $translator
Результат string